WebJun 4, 2024 · MANUAL FLASH POWER SETTING. If you have been messing around with manual flash power, you will notice that we need to set some numbers – 1, 1/2, 1/4, 1/32, 1/128, etc…. We will not go into the rocket science Math, but in the human terms: 1 means “full blast”. 1/128 means “as little as possible”. 0… is off.
